Key Facts
- Solute carrier family 25 (mitochondrial carrier, dicarboxylate transporter), member 10's instance of is recorded as protein[2].
- Solute carrier family 25 (mitochondrial carrier, dicarboxylate transporter), member 10's UniProt protein ID is recorded as Q9QZD8[3].
- Solute carrier family 25 (mitochondrial carrier, dicarboxylate transporter), member 10's part of is recorded as Mitochondrial carrier UCP-like[4].
- Solute carrier family 25 (mitochondrial carrier, dicarboxylate transporter), member 10's part of is recorded as mitochondrial carrier domain superfamily[5].
- Solute carrier family 25 (mitochondrial carrier, dicarboxylate transporter), member 10's part of is recorded as Mitochondrial substrate/solute carrier, protein family[6].
- Solute carrier family 25 (mitochondrial carrier, dicarboxylate transporter), member 10's has part is recorded as Mitochondrial substrate/solute carrier[7].
- Solute carrier family 25 (mitochondrial carrier, dicarboxylate transporter), member 10's RefSeq protein ID is recorded as NP_038798[8].
- Solute carrier family 25 (mitochondrial carrier, dicarboxylate transporter), member 10's molecular function is recorded as secondary active transmembrane transporter activity[9].
- Solute carrier family 25 (mitochondrial carrier, dicarboxylate transporter), member 10's molecular function is recorded as phosphate ion transmembrane transporter activity[10].
- Solute carrier family 25 (mitochondrial carrier, dicarboxylate transporter), member 10's molecular function is recorded as sulfate transmembrane transporter activity[11].
- Solute carrier family 25 (mitochondrial carrier, dicarboxylate transporter), member 10's molecular function is recorded as thiosulfate transmembrane transporter activity[12].
- Solute carrier family 25 (mitochondrial carrier, dicarboxylate transporter), member 10's molecular function is recorded as oxaloacetate transmembrane transporter activity[13].
- Solute carrier family 25 (mitochondrial carrier, dicarboxylate transporter), member 10's molecular function is recorded as malate transmembrane transporter activity[14].
- Solute carrier family 25 (mitochondrial carrier, dicarboxylate transporter), member 10's molecular function is recorded as succinate transmembrane transporter activity[15].
- Solute carrier family 25 (mitochondrial carrier, dicarboxylate transporter), member 10's molecular function is recorded as antiporter activity[16].
